手机APP开发是一个复杂的过程,涉及到多个步骤和准备工作。以下是一些关键的准备工作:
1. 市场调研与需求分析:在开始开发之前,需要对目标市场进行深入的调研,了解潜在用户的需求、行为习惯和偏好。这有助于确定APP的功能定位、设计方向和用户体验。
2. 功能规划与设计:根据市场调研结果,制定APP的功能模块和业务流程。同时,进行界面设计和交互设计,确保APP的外观美观、操作便捷且符合用户需求。
3. 技术选型与团队组建:选择合适的开发技术和工具,如iOS平台的开发语言(Swift或Objective-C)、Android平台的Java或Kotlin等。此外,还需要组建一个专业的开发团队,包括设计师、产品经理、UI/UX设计师、前端工程师、后端工程师等。
4. 原型设计与开发:在初步设计完成后,制作APP的原型图,以便团队成员和潜在用户能够直观地了解APP的结构和功能。然后开始开发,按照原型图逐步实现各个功能模块。
5. 测试与调试:在开发过程中,需要进行多轮测试,包括单元测试、集成测试、性能测试和安全测试等。发现问题后及时进行调试和修复,确保APP的稳定性和可靠性。
6. 上线前的准备:在APP开发完成后,需要进行一系列的上线前准备工作,如服务器搭建、数据库设计、支付接口对接等。同时,还需要准备宣传推广材料,如应用商店截图、宣传视频等,以便在上线后吸引用户下载和使用。
7. 上线与运营:在准备好所有上线条件后,将APP提交到应用商店进行审核,通过审核后即可正式上线。上线后,还需要进行持续的运营和维护,如更新内容、优化性能、处理用户反馈等,以保持APP的活跃度和竞争力。
8. 数据分析与优化:通过对APP的运营数据进行分析,了解用户行为和需求变化,不断优化APP的功能和体验。同时,关注行业动态和技术发展趋势,以便及时调整开发策略,保持APP的领先地位。
总之,手机APP开发需要做好充分的准备工作,从市场调研与需求分析、功能规划与设计、技术选型与团队组建、原型设计与开发、测试与调试、上线前的准备、上线与运营,到数据分析与优化等多个环节。只有做好这些准备工作,才能开发出一款成功的手机APP。